While regional food like BBQ, fried chicken, and biscuits are delicious, you may be looking to explore unique spices, textures, and flavors. If you can identify with this, head to Galax and the GX Asian Market for Vietnamese and Asian-inspired cuisine. 

Formerly known as ST Vietnamese Restaurant, this quaint family-operated eatery is your go-to-market and restaurant for Asian food in Galax. The menu is the talk of the town, with tasty pho, dumplings, egg rolls, and pad Thai. 

This quaint eatery may be tricky to locate, but it's well worth the effort. It occupies a small interior space in a historical limestone building in downtown Galax. The small sign above the doorway can be easy to miss. However, if the weather is nice, look for outdoor patio tables and a blackboard menu.   

The various menu offerings are perfect before or after a day exploring nearby Blue Ridge Music Center. GX Asian Market is the crossroad of Appalachian music and culture with Eastern flavors and textures. 

If you enjoy cooking, the market has everything you'll need to whip up a batch of Asian noodles or similar dishes. You'll find traditional items like miso paste, kimchi, sesame oil, and pho broth that you won't find at a local grocery store.

Vibe

As mentioned, it can be easy to miss spotting this eatery, but when the wind blows right and you catch a whiff of the delicious cuisine from inside, you'll know you're close!

The corner entrance to the massive limestone building looks more like a door into a forgotten warehouse. But step inside, and your senses will be rewarded. 

The small interior is home to the market with shelves and displays ripe with Asian spices and sundries. Sharing this space is an area with tables for diners. A handful of tables grace the area beside a wall with wallpaper depicting a bamboo stand. Garden lights drape from the low ceiling to offer mood lighting, while the open kitchen and display are the gateway to delicious cuisine. 

The mood at GX Asian Market is charming and friendly, making you feel like you're in someone's home. 

GX Asian Market: Menu & Drinks

Step inside this quaint eatery and market and discover a hidden gem of flavors. Even if you're unfamiliar with Vietnamese food, plenty of other choices make it worth visiting. 

The Beef Pho is a favorite with guests and a good starting point when trying Vietnamese food for the first time. This entree consists of savory beef broth that's rich and flavorful. Cuts of beef, rice noodles, green onions, cilantro, and bean sprouts are added to the broth. This pho is an Asian "comfort food" that is not to be missed.

Pad Thai is another popular choice that combines vinegar-based sweet sauce with a spicy kick to cover stir-fried rice noodles, thinly sliced chicken, bean sprouts, onions, cilantro, and roasted peanuts. The combination of sweet and sour with the textures of the noodles and chicken makes this dish shine.

A similar-style dish is grilled pork with rice noodles, lettuce, cilantro, cucumber, and crushed peanuts, all cooked in a savory fish sauce. Add two egg rolls, and this meal is the perfect ending to a visit to the Old Cranks Motorcar Museum

The drinks menu complements the food offerings with assorted bubble tea flavors and soft drinks.

Local Tips

  • The market is closed on Sunday & Monday, and the restaurant is closed Saturday through Monday.
  • Ask the staff for cooking tips and ingredient recommendations.
  • Check their Facebook page and sidewalk chalkboard for daily specials.
